STAND ILMIODESIGN INTERIHOTEL | Location: Barcelona |  Year: 2018 | Photography: Guillermo Ortega

We plumped for a retro aesthetic, inspired by the 1970s and Verner Panton designs, with bright and warm colours such as red and orange. And also lots of geometric patterns, which were very popular in Italy in the 70s in Kartell's designs from that decade. We took inspiration from the tones of Miami clubs and mid-century American motels with carpets, designer pieces and strident colours such as orange and turquoise. For the structures, both the headboard and other elements were inspired by pavement designs, very geometric and full of arched drawings. We wanted the perfect hotel room, yet always stunning and instantly Instagrammable. That's why we created a room where everything flows, but in which the main space - the bed - has a privileged and perfectly framed place for social media posts.
